Game Recommendation Until Elden Ring Arrives(Time to ripoff Reddit lol) : Metro Exodus. I haven't finished it and I am probably halfway trough but it's definitely a game you might want to check out if you are looking for something similar to long expeditions of DS1. Especially on Ranger difficulty. It's been a long while since I was genuinely looking for ways to survive in a survival game and Metro accomplished this imo. Should I go out at night or day? Should I explore area more for supplies or should I head to mission? Is my ammo enough for me to survive etc. I can say Metro isn't a discount Half Life anymore but more like a Stalker game. Semi open world nature makes it way more distinct than it's predecessors. As far as I can tell it's worst Metro game in terms of story but it's best in terms of gameplay. If you liked other Metro games before you may like it much more depending on what you are looking in a Metro game.

If you guys don't mind 2D Souls-like, Hyper Light Drifter is a gem. Fast-paced combat with a lot of depth, mysterious world with secrets revealed through snippets of lore and environmental storytelling, ambient piano + 8-bit soundtrack that really helps set tone/atmosphere, and awesome art direction — there's so much this game gets right.
